From the Customers menu, select Create Invoices. At the top of the invoice, select the Invoice template selection button and choose Edit Template. This opens the Layout Designer view. Choose File at the top of the Layout Designer. You can now export or import the template as desired.
Go to the Lists menu. Choose Templates. On the page, click the drop-down button beside Templates. Select New, then choose the Template Type. Hit OK. Then to check the available details, click Additional Customization. Click Layout Designer.
